Lance Stroll was the man to go fastest in the first, and only, practice session for the Chinese Grand Prix weekend.
With F1 cars returning to the Shanghai International Circuit for the first time since 2019, the Aston Martin racer was fastest with a 1m 36.302s – leading the McLaren of Oscar Piastri by 0.327s.
FP1: Stroll leads Piastri and Verstappen in busy first practice as F1 returns to China
Max Verstappen was third fastest, followed by his Red Bull team mate Sergio Perez, in a session that was briefly red flagged following a small fire on the trackside grass at Turn 7.
